fyi... i just tried the above opkg upgrade in screen and got disconnected. openssh does get installed, but you need to go into terminal and run "/etc/ init.d/sshd start". The default in openssh is to deny root logins so you need to create another account with adduser if you haven't before. _______________________________________________ Shr-User mailing list [email protected] http://lists.shr-project.org/mailman/listinfo/shr-user
